In an era when the cinema industry has wrestled with its own relevance, HOYTS has answered with something unprecedented: two of the largest LED screens ever installed in a working multiplex, the bigger of which now holds a world record at Karrinyup, Western Australia. Built in partnership with GDC Technology, the APEX format is less a product launch than a philosophical wager — that the future of communal screen experience lies not in incremental projection upgrades, but in a fundamental reimagining of light, sound, and space.
